SuiteTraveler Posted May 20, 2016 #2 Share Posted May 20, 2016 Here's the info you need: http://www.therockboat.com/prices/included/ "In addition to admission to all cruise concerts, the price of your room also includes: Round trip cruise from Port of Tampa to Harvest Caye, Belize & Costa Maya, Mexico All meals (there's gourmet fare in the formal dining rooms, casual indoor and outdoor grills open for meals throughout the day). Non-carbonated beverages (i.e. tea, juices, coffee). Use of the ship's pool and hot tubs* (all with plenty of deck space to enjoy a cocktail and some great music). Use of the Norwegian Jade's amenities such as: casino, health and fitness center, full-size sports court, and video arcade. Norwegian's Youth Program facilities and activities if you're bringing children.** Taxes, port charges and ticketing are added at check-out and pre-paid by you ($225.00 per person). * Due to stage placement and weather conditions, some pools and hot tubs may be closed for safety during the cruise. **From time to time, adjustments are made to children’s program hours and locations as required by our scheduled activities. Not included are: Gratuities (vary from $13.50-$15.50 per person, per day based on cabin selection as shown here.) Gambling Spa Alcoholic beverages Soft drinks & bottled water. (However, a package is available for a low price which gets you unlimited soft drinks throughout the cruise.) While many restaurants on board are FREE, some Specialty Restaurants you choose to go to require a cover charge. (Pricing for each can be found here.) $7.95 Room Service Convenience charge Any meals, events or tours in the ports Pre-cruise or post-cruise hotels - see our Hotels page for details. Airfare Ground transportation Travel insurance (available through Sixthman) GET UPDA"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

MichelleUK Posted May 22, 2016 #18 Share Posted May 22, 2016 Sixthman operate a slightly cutdown version of the Latitudes program, details are here: http://www.sixthman.net/latitudes/ At the moment, Sixthman do not offer the Ultimate Beverage Package. Sixthman cruisers have noticed that NCL have been offering UBP on other charters recently, so Sixthman is having discussions with NCL to see if anything can be done to offer it or at least some kind of alcohol discounts.
